NWJHL Playoffs Round 2 – Fort St. John vs Fairview

nwjhl-huskies-vs-flyers-png

The other second round matchup in the NWJHL pits the Fort St. John Huskies against the Fairview Flyers in the semi-finals. Fort St. John is the number 1 seed with a 33-5-2 record for 66 points. Fairview is the number 4 seed and beat the Grande Prairie Kings three games to two in the first round.

Season Series
October 11 – Fairview 3-2 SO
October 26 – Fort St. John 4-3
November 2 – Fairview 2-1 OT
November 10 – Fort St. John 8-1
November 28 – Fort St. John 3-2 OT
January 18 – Fort St. John 10-2
January 24 – Fort St. John 5-2
February 14 – Fort St. John 2-1
